Papua New Guinea

Papua New Guinea presents a unique danger for tourists, with tribal conflicts and limited infrastructure elevating risks beyond most Pacific destinations. The country records 73 homicides per 100,000 people, a rate three times higher than the developing world average and outpacing Haiti in violent deaths. Sexual violence rates are among the highest in the region, with 60% of women reporting lifetime assault. Trekking the Kokoda Trail, a popular tourist draw, sees an average of two rescue operations per month due to attacks or accidents. With only 5% of roads paved and police response times often exceeding hours, visitors must plan as if for an expedition rather than a vacation, relying on armed escorts for any rural travel.
